About the Student Council

The Student Council, governed by the Constitution and Bylaws for the Student Council, is elected by the student body.  Officers are elected from the Upper School and two class representatives are elected from each class, Grades 4-8.  Students eligible to become Student Council officers must meet the following criteria based on the year in which they are elected and on the year in which they serve.  Representatives must meet the criteria based on the year before they are elected and on the year in which they serve.  The criteria is as follows:

  • proven history of honesty/integrity
  • leadership ability
  • no suspensions
  • no more than 5 checks in any given month*
  • maintain at least a “C” average for classroom representatives and at least a “B” average for officers

* any Student Council student exceeding this number will be put on probation the following month, continued tenure will be subject to the discretion of the Student Council moderator

The Student Council provides a forum through which student issues may be raised and addressed.  Officers meet regularly with the Principal and Faculty Moderator.  The Student Council sponsors various spirit-building activities, helps the school become a more cohesive body, and provides leadership.  Proceeds from fundraisers go to charity or toward activities or equipment that will enhance the life of the school.
